git远程分支拉到本地
时间: 2023-11-04 07:01:12 浏览: 277
要将git远程分支拉取到本地,可以按照以下步骤操作:
1. 首先,确定本地是否已经初始化为git仓库。如果没有,请使用git init命令初始化。
2. 使用git remote add命令将本地仓库与远程仓库建立连接。命令格式为:git remote add origin 远程仓库链接。
3. 使用git fetch命令将远程分支拉取到本地。命令格式为:git fetch origin 远程分支名。
4. 切换到需要拉取的远程分支。可以使用git checkout命令切换到该分支,命令格式为:git checkout -b 本地分支名 origin/远程分支名。
5. 使用git pull命令将远程分支上的内容拉取到本地。命令格式为:git pull origin 远程分支名。
请注意,这些命令和步骤适用于大多数情况,但具体的操作可能会因实际情况而有所不同。
相关问题
git合并远程分支到本地
要将远程分支合并到本地分支,可以按照以下步骤执行:
1. 确保你已经克隆了远程仓库到本地并且已经切换到正确的本地分支。
```
git clone <远程仓库地址>
cd <克隆的仓库文件夹>
git checkout <本地分支名称>
```
2. 拉取最新的远程分支代码到本地分支。
```
git pull origin <远程分支名称>
```
3. 如果你只想合并特定的远程分支到本地分支,可以使用以下命令:
```
git merge origin/<远程分支名称>
```
如果你想将远程分支合并到当前所在的本地分支,可以省略远程分支名称:
```
git merge origin
```
4. 如果合并过程中有冲突,需要手动解决冲突。使用 `git status` 命令查看有冲突的文件,并打开这些文件进行编辑以解决冲突。
5. 提交合并后的代码。
```
git add .
git commit -m "合并远程分支到本地分支"
```
6. 最后,将本地分支推送到远程仓库。
```
git push origin <本地分支名称>
```
这样,你就成功将远程分支合并到了本地分支。
git 把远程所有分支拉到本地
要将远程仓库的所有分支拉取到本地,你可以按照以下步骤进行操作:
1. 首先,使用 `git fetch` 命令从远程仓库获取最新的分支信息。这个命令会将远程仓库的分支更新到本地的远程跟踪分支中,但不会自动合并或更新你的本地分支。
2. 接下来,可以使用 `git branch -r` 命令查看所有的远程分支列表。这将显示所有已经从远程仓库获取到的分支。
3. 如果你想要在本地创建并跟踪远程分支,可以使用 `git checkout -b <local_branch_name> <remote_branch_name>` 命令。在这个命令中,`<local_branch_name>` 是你想要创建的本地分支的名称,`<remote_branch_name>` 是你想要拉取的远程分支的名称。
4. 如果你只是想查看远程分支的代码,而不创建本地分支,可以使用 `git checkout <remote_branch_name>` 命令。这会将你的 HEAD 指针指向远程分支,但不会创建本地分支。
5. 如果你希望将所有远程分支都拉取到本地并创建相应的本地分支,可以使用以下命令:
```
git branch -r | grep -v '\->' | while read remote; do git branch --track "${remote#origin/}" "$remote"; done
```
这个命令会遍历所有的远程分支,并在本地创建相应的分支,并与远程分支进行跟踪。
通过执行以上步骤,你就可以将远程仓库的所有分支拉取到本地了。如果有任何其他问题,请随时提问。